Warning Signs You Need Industrial Dehumidification

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Our team is here to help you identify and address these issues before they become major problems.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ent, unpleasant odor in your home, it could be a sign of hidden moisture. Don’t ignore it; call us to schedule an inspection and get rid of the smell for good.

Warped or Buckled Wood

Warped or buckled wood can be a sign of excessive moisture. If left unchecked, this can lead to costly repairs and even structural damage.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t delay; call us to schedule an inspection and get to the root of the problem.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th can be a serious health risk. If you notice any signs of mold or mildew, call us immediately to schedule an inspection and get rid of the problem for good.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ks in your home can be a sign of hidden moisture or structural damage. Don’t ignore it; call us to schedule an inspection and get to the bottom of the issue.

High Humidity Levels

High humidity levels can lead to musty odors, warping wood, and structural dam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late; call us to schedule an inspection and get your home back to a safe and healthy environment.

Industrial Dehumidification v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Hidden water damage in a small area Yes No You can use a portable dehumidifier to remove excess moisture.
Musty odors and warping wood in a large area No Yes Industrial-grade dehumidifiers are needed to tackle large areas and prevent structural damage.
Water stains or discoloration on walls or ceilings No Yes A professional inspection is needed to identify the source and extent of the moisture issue.
Mold or mildew growth in a small area Yes No You can use a mold-killing solution and a portable dehumidifier to remove excess moisture.
High humidity levels in a large area No Yes Industrial-grade dehumidifiers are needed to remove excess moisture and prevent structural damage.

Industrial Dehumidification Cost in Layton, UT

The cost of Industrial Dehumidification in Layton, UT, can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on real-world costs and can range from $500 to $2,500 or more.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ment $100 – $500 Size of affected area and severity of issue
Equipment Setup $500 – $2,000 Number and type of dehumidifiers needed
Continuous Monitoring $200 – $1,000 Duration of monitoring and frequency of checks
Final Inspection and Cleanup $100 – $500 Size of affected area and type of cleanup needed
